From the beginning... After reading the reviews of this game from before it was released, I begged for it for my birthday or Christmas (they're close together) but ended up buying it for myself instead since I saw all the trailers and such and got all hyped-up about it. I started with a budget-end computer, and had to upgrade numerous things (add a graphics card, get a more powerful processor, etc.) in order to get the BEST out of this game. The game blew me away from the beginning, and it's so immersive that I would play for hours on end. You get a lot out of the main quest, but my favorite part is the sandbox open-endedness of the game... You might find a building guarded by some robots or mutants, then a few hours later, you come out of it with an insane new weapon or some powerful armor! It was buggy initially, often crashing to the desktop a few times per hour, so I made sure to download the patches from the official website. These helped with the glitches and other bugs that plagued the game. Then the DLC's started coming, and those were outstanding too. They let you get some awesome new gear and explore areas that seem to come out of a dream (or nightmare). Over a year later, I'm still playing it at least twice a week. Replay value? Out the roof.

I'm running this game on a PC with an NVIDIA GeForce 9800 GT graphics card with 3 gigs of RAM. If you are running it on a computer as equally good or better I can honestly say you will enjoy this game a lot. I originally bought this game on the PS3 which so far was a better experience overall. The PS3 had longer load times but there were beautiful specular and reflective visuals which is hard to find in the PC version even when running it on full visual settings. However the PC version has sharper graphics with textures that are a lot more crisp. On the bad side the texture pop-in and object fade-in is very abrupt where as the PS3 version was very smooth. But more importantly than visuals is gameplay. I found that there is almost no lag in the game, the only time I experienced lag was when I used the Xbox 360 controller, which is fine because I prefer the keyboard and mouse anyway. The game crashed on me a few times but that is just my PC and might be uncommon on most PC's but even if you are worried about that you can just quick-save often like I do. The best thing about this version of the game is it includes all 5 of the DLC's at a great price. I would recommend this game to anyone that likes RPG elements combined with action shooters and a deep story. I give the game itself a 10 out of 10.
